Observations on the European Racing Scene turns the spotlight on the best European races of the day, highlighting well-bred horses early in their careers, horses of note returning to action and young runners that achieved notable results in the sales ring. Sunday's Observations features the return of a 'TDN Rising Star'.

1.30 Naas, Cond, €40,000, 2yo, 5fT
CHARLES DARWIN (IRE) (No Nay Never) drops back in trip having put in a TDN Rising Star performance when scoring by 5 1/2 lengths over nearly six at Navan last month. The full-brother to Blackbeard is going to be heading to Royal Ascot with plenty of experience under his belt at this rate.

3.45 Newmarket, Novice, £21,000, 2yo, 6fT
TREANMOR (IRE) (Frankel {GB}) is out relatively early for a precious €2 million Goffs Orby Book 1 topper, with Charlie Appleby starting him in the same race he won 12 months ago with the ill-fated G2 Superlative Stakes winner and G1 Dewhurst Stakes third Ancient Truth. Out of Invincible Spirit's Listed scorer and dual Group 3-placed Loch Lein, Godolphin's exciting colt faces five fellow newcomers.
